Bournemouth's Antoine Semenyo scored two goals after reporting racist abuse from a Liverpool fan during their match at Anfield. The incident temporarily paused the game, and the offending fan was removed from the stadium. Bournemouth captain Adam Smith praised Semenyo's composure and resilience, expressing shock and anger over the incident. Both the Premier League and the FA condemned the abuse and vowed to investigate. Liverpool also released a statement condemning racism and supporting the investigation.
